Welch's
  • Marketing
  • Concord, MA, USA
  • Full Time

We're Welch's.  You may know us for the great tasting juice and jelly you had as a kid, but we're so much more.  We're a co-operative, owned by farmers and this is at the heart of what we do.  We constantly strive for innovative and collaborative ways to approach our work and our customers.  We value passion:  passion for our grapes, our brand and our people.  We're honest and real with a shared purpose.  And we're building a team that's playing to win and daring to try new things.

We're looking for a Consumer and Market Insights Manager (CMI) to join our team. This role is highly visible within the Organization working with Marketing, Sales, R&D and the opportunity to work with senior leaders across the Business. You will have a seat at the table where you can listen, make your case and affect the decisions made by Welch's for the short and long term.

Who You Are:

  • You love people and are knowledgeable on how consumers make decisions. A passionate, creative problem solver, who wants to work in an organization with a clear vision that will invest in you, develop you and want you to lead.
  • Well versed in the CMI industry to understand what is appropriate for Welch's
  • Be able to synthesize insights from disparate sources such as primary, secondary and syndicated
  • Knowledge in areas such as brand equity, positioning, segmentation and demand spaces, concept development, volumetric methods, new product development processes, creative and media evaluation, measuring success in market and how to track progress
  • Strong ability to speak to insights with passion, understanding and candor
  • Someone who can drive big picture strategic thinking and programs while also able to lead tactical execution on a day-to-day level
  • Ability to think through complex problems and solve less-than-straightforward scenarios with creativity and strategic thinking.

What You'll Do:

  • Be part of the strategic growth planning process for the organization as an advocate for the consumer
  • Provide in-depth understanding of the consumer, customer and marketplace
  • Lead and develop insights roadmap against business objectives
  • Work with partners to design, execute, analyze data and mine for insights
  • Integrate data to cross reference and build on foundational learning for insights
  • Simplify complex methods and data to get to the point with actionable recommendations
  • Identify where to spend time to move the business forward
  • You will roll up your sleeves to get the job done with speed and accuracy.

What You'll Need:

  • Bachelor's Degree, MBA, or higher, CMI related fields such as psychology, marketing.
  • Minimum 5 years of CMI experience

What You'll Enjoy:

  • Collaborative colleagues working together to deliver results.
  • Flexible work schedules
  • Robust health benefits, and paid time off programs
  • Generous 401k plan with annual company match

Welch's is an Equal Employment Opportunity Employer:  Minority/Female/Disability/Protected Veteran

Welch's
  • Apply Now

  • * Fields Are Required

    What is your full name?

    How can we contact you?

  • Sign Up For Job Alerts!

  • Share This Page
  • Facebook Twitter LinkedIn Email
.
Contact Us Products Our Story Health and Nutrition Recipes Logo Career About Welchs FAQ Where to Buy